Why Hospitality Needs AI Chatbots

Here’s why hotels, resorts, and travel companies are rapidly integrating AI chatbots into their customer experience strategies.

  • Instant Guest Assistance, Day or Night - Guests expect immediate answers whether it’s about check-in times or room service availability. Chatbots ensure 24/7 responsiveness without expanding staff.

  • Simplified Bookings and Reservations - Chatbots can guide users through room selection, availability, and booking steps, reducing drop-offs and abandoned carts.

  • Upsell Add-ons and Local Experiences - AI agents can offer spa services, dining packages, or nearby tours based on guest preferences driving revenue per booking.

  • Multilingual Support for Global Guests - Hospitality businesses serve international travelers. With support for 95+ languages, pagergpt  ensures clear communication across the globe.

  • Feedback Collection and Sentiment Analysis - Bots can automatically collect feedback during or after a stay and identify dissatisfaction in real-time, helping prevent negative reviews. Explore more in our post on ai agents for customer engagement.

  • Operational Efficiency for Front Desk and Support - From check-out queries to parking details, bots handle routine questions allowing staff to focus on personalized service.

Step-by-Step Guide to Train Your Hospitality Chatbot

Building a high-performing hospitality chatbot starts with clear intent, quality data, and a platform that fits your workflow.

Step 1 - Define Guest Journeys and Use Cases

Outline key touchpoints: booking, check-in, stay, concierge services, complaints, and post-checkout feedback. Map each to an automated conversation flow.

Step 2 - Gather Relevant Content and Policies

Pull together FAQs, room details, cancellation policies, check-in/out times, amenities, and service descriptions to serve as training material.

Step 3 - Choose a Guest-Friendly Chatbot Platform

Select a no-code, secure platform like pagergpt  that supports custom GPT, third-party integrations, and multilingual training for global hospitality operations.

Step 4 - Train Your Bot Using Structured & Unstructured Data

Ingest documents, PDFs, SOPs, or content from your website and Notion. With add custom GPTs to your website, you can directly pull live hospitality content into the chatbot's brain.

Step 5 - Automate Guest Tasks with Integrated Actions

Enable the bot to confirm bookings, cancel reservations, offer directions, or handle payments using automated customer support workflows linked to apps like Stripe, Calendly, and CRMs.

Step 6 - Set Escalation Protocols

For VIP guests, escalated issues, or sensitive topics, use pagergpt’s live inbox to route queries to your front desk or customer success team.

Step 7 - Test for Hospitality Edge Cases

Simulate scenarios like “Late check-out options?”, “Do you have vegan breakfast?” or “Can I cancel without charge?” to refine responses and tone.

Challenges with Hospitality Chatbots

While AI offers automation and scale, hospitality presents a few nuanced hurdles for chatbot success.

  • Handling Guest Emotions and Expectations - Unlike e-commerce, hospitality involves emotions. Bots must balance professionalism with warmth and urgency, especially for escalations.

  • Frequent Service Updates - From seasonal pricing to availability of amenities, chatbots must be synced regularly to avoid misinformation.

  • Complex Multilingual Contexts - Guests may switch languages or use mixed phrasing. Without fine-tuned language training, bots may misinterpret key requests.

  • Booking Integration Complexity - Legacy PMS or booking engines may require middleware for smooth syncing of data like room availability or reservation status.

  • Privacy Compliance for Guest Data - Handling passport info, payment methods, and personal details requires bots to be GDPR-compliant and secure.

Best Practices for Maintaining Hospitality Chatbots

To ensure lasting value, your chatbot must evolve with your property, brand, and guest expectations.

  • Update Policies Regularly: Adjust cancellation or health policies as they change to avoid confusion.

  • Use Feedback Loops: Incorporate feedback collected via bot to improve responses and address missed topics.

  • Train for Local Attractions: Include nearby restaurants, experiences, or transportation options to provide concierge-like assistance.

  • Respect Guest Data: Use opt-ins and secure storage to protect personally identifiable information.

  • Run Sentiment Analytics: Use built-in AI tools to track guest satisfaction and spot service gaps.

  • Align Bot Tone with Property Type: A luxury resort and a business hostel require different conversational tones and flows.
